Faculty, University of Wisconsin School of Medicine and Public HealthDr. Shah earned her medical degree from T. National Medical College, University of Bombay, India and completed her residency at St. Joseph's Hospital and University of Illinois Hospital. She completed her fellowship at Vanderbilt University Hospital and is board certified in pediatrics and neonatal-perinatal medicine.
